Santa Fé
City in Veraguas, Panama
Overview
Santa Fé is a quaint mountain town in the Veraguas province of Panama, renowned for its cool climate and surrounding cloud forests. The community is friendly, local and embraces a slower pace of life, making it an ideal destination for eco-tourism and cultural immersion.
